W397 ODE is a 2000 Mercedes-benz Sprinter in Blue with a 2,151c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 28 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 67.9%.
Across all 2000 Mercedes-benz Sprinter models, the average MOT pass rate is 65.7% with a typical mileage of 157,576 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Mercedes-benz Sprinter fails its MOT is parking brake: efficiency below requirements, accounting for 175,127 recorded failures. If you're considering buying W397 ODE,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Mercedes-benz Sprinter typically stays on UK roads for around 30 years. At 26 years old, this Mercedes-benz Sprinter is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
